Renesas M16C/62P Series Hardware Manual page 183

6-bit single-chip microcomputer
Table of Contents

Advertisement

M16C/62P Group (M16C/62P, M16C/62PT)
Three-Phase Control Register 1
b7 b6 b5 b4 b3 b2 b1 b0
0
NOTES :
1.
Rew rite the INVC1 register after the PRC1 bit in the PRCR register is set to "1" (w rite enable).
The timers A1, A2, A4, and B2 must be stopped during rew rite.
2.
The follow ing table lists how the INV11 bit w orks.
Item
Mode
TA11, TA21 and TA41
Registers
INV00 and INV01 Bit
INV13 Bit
3.
When the INV06 bit is set to "1" (saw tooth w ave modulation mode), set the INV11 bit to "0" (three-phase mode 0).
Also, w hen the INV11 bit is set to "0", set the PWCON bit in the TB2SC register to "0" (Timer B2 is reloaded w hen
Timer B2 underflow s).
4.
The INV13 bit is enabled only w hen the INV06 bit is set to "0" (Triangular w ave modulation mode) and the INV11 bit to
"1" (three-phase mode 1).
5.
If the follow ing conditions are all met, set the INV16 bit to "1" (rising edge of the three-phase output shift register).
• The INV15 bit is set to "0" (dead time timer enabled)
• The Dij bit (i=U, V or W, j=0, 1) and DiBj bit alw ays have different values w hen the INV03 bit is set to "1".
(The positive-phase and negative-phase alw ays output opposite level signals.)
If above conditions are not met, set the INV16 bit to "0" (falling edge of a one-shot pulse of Timer A1, A2, A4).
Figure 16.3
INVC1 Register
Rev.2.41
Jan 10, 2006
REJ09B0185-0241
http://www.xinpian.net
(1)
Symbol
Address
0349h
INVC1
Bit Symbol
Bit Name
Timer A1, A2 and A4 Start
INV10
Trigger Select Bit
Timer A1-1, A2-1 and A4-1
INV11
(2, 3)
Control Bit
Dead Time Timer Count
INV12
Source Select Bit
Carrier Wave Detect Bit
INV13
Output Polarity Control Bit
INV14
Dead Time Disable Bit
INV15
Dead Time Timer Trigger
Select Bit
INV16
Reserved Bit
(b7)
Three-phase mode 0
Not used
Disabled.
The ICTB2 counter is incremented
w henever Timer B2 underflow s
Disabled
Page 168 of 390
提供单片机解密、IC解密、芯片解密业务
16. Three-Phase Motor Control Timer Function
0 : Timer B2 underflow
1 : Timer B2 underflow and w rite to Timer B2
0 : Three-phase mode 0
1 : Three-phase mode 1
0 : f1 or f2
1 : f1 divided-by-2 or f2 divided-by-2
(4)
0 : Timer A1 reload control signal is "0"
1 : Timer A1 reload control signal is "1"
0 : Active "L" of an output w aveform
1 : Active "H" of an output w aveform
0 : Enables dead time
1 : Disables dead time
0 : Falling edge of a one-shot pulse of Timer A1,
A2, A4
(5)
1 : Rising edge of the three-phase output shift
register (U-, V-, W-phase)
Set to "0"
INV11=0
Three-phase mode 1
Used
Enabled
Enabled w hen INV11=1 and INV06=0
After Reset
00h
Function
INV11=1
010-62245566 13810019655
RW
RW
RW
RW
RO
RW
RW
RW
RW

Advertisement

Table of Contents
loading

This manual is also suitable for:

M16c/62pM16c/62pt

Table of Contents